Lawyer Salary in Middletown, CT: $163,024 (2026)

Quick Answer:A full-time lawyer in Middletown, CT earns a median $163,024/year (≈ $78.38/hour) in nominal terms for 2026 — proj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 23-1011). Once you factor in Middletown's price level (8% above national, BEA RPP 107.9), that paycheck buys what $151,088 would nationally. Nominal pay sits 1.1% below the Connecticut state average.

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for the Middletown metropolitan area, the median lawyer salary grew 29.9% from $119,907 (2019) to $155,706 (2025). At a 4.70% compound annual growth rate, salaries are projected to reach $170,686 by 2027 — a total increase of $50,779 (42.35%) from 2019.

Note: Historical values (20192025) are actual BLS OEWS figures for the Middletown metropolitan area, sourced from annual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ics surveys. 20262026 figures are current estimates, and 2027 values are projections, calculated using a 4.70% CAGR derived from 7-year BLS historical data. What is the cost-of-living adjusted lawyer salary in Middletown?

After adjusting for Middletown's cost-of-living index of 107.9 (where 100 equals the national average), the $163,024 nominal salary has purchasing power equivalent to $151,088 in an average-cost city. This means living costs in Middletown reduce the effective value of your salary by 7.3% compared to the national average — consider negotiating higher base pay or exploring nearby lower-cost metros.
